Xiamen-Shantou-Guangzhou Trip
Q: This is our itinerary this Xmas. Is the quickest and safest way to go from Shantou to Guangzhou by private car? And what is the approximate cost and travel time? Thank you!
If you go by long distance bus from Shantou to Guangzhou, a ticket for one costs 120-180 yuan per person, depending on the quality of the bus you take. There are many departures during the day. The highway distance between Shantou and Guangzhou is 450 km. The bus trip takes 4-5 hours. The two cities are connected by freeways.
By "private car", do you mean a rented car? You can probably rent a car along with a driver, but this does cost some money. In Guangzhou, for instance, 400-500 yuan gets you a car along with a driver for 10 hours, but there is a mileage limit of 250 km; every additional km costs one dollar more. Nor does this does include gas, parking or tolls (tolls for the trip between Shantou and Guangzhou is about 200 yuan). Sometimes you can negotiate a deal with a taxi driver who is willing to do long distance, but you should know what you're getting into to avoid misunderstandings, etc. You may get a good deal, but you may also be looking at 1,500 yuan or so to travel by a private car from Shantou to Guangzhou.
If you fly from Shantou to Guangzhou and get your ticket at a discounted price, a one-way flight costs 550-700 Chinese dollars.
One can also get from Shantou to Guangzhou by train. A soft-seat ticket costs 90 yuan; a sleeping berth ticket costs 150-220 yuan. However, the trip takes 7 to 8 hours, so this does not seem to be as good as going by bus.
